.singleOpportunity{padding-top:52px}.singleOpportunity__image{margin-bottom:72px;border-radius:16px;overflow:hidden}@media only screen and (max-width:992px){.singleOpportunity__image{margin-bottom:56px}}@media only screen and (max-width:769px){.singleOpportunity__image{margin-bottom:48px}}.singleOpportunity__image img{aspect-ratio:1/.45}.singleOpportunity__title{margin-bottom:24px}.singleOpportunity__tags{margin-bottom:24px;display:-ms-flexbox;display:flex;gap:8px}.singleOpportunity__tagsItem{border-radius:100px;padding:6px 20px 6px 24px;font-weight:600;line-height:1.429;display:-ms-flexbox;display:flex;border:1px solid #003153}@media only screen and (max-width:769px){.singleOpportunity__tagsItem{padding:5px 15px 5px 17px}}.singleOpportunity__tagsItem img,.singleOpportunity__tagsItem svg{width:20px;height:20px;margin-left:-4px;margin-right:8px}.singleOpportunity__tagsItem__icon{display:-ms-flexbox;display:flex;width:20px;height:20px}.singleOpportunity__tagsItem.bg--light-blue{-ms-flex-order:-1;order:-1}.singleOpportunity__tagsItem--border{border:1px solid #003153;padding:5px 20px 5px 23px}@media only screen and (max-width:769px){.singleOpportunity__tagsItem--border{padding:4px 14px 4px 16px}}.singleOpportunity__tagsItem:first-child{background-color:#d1e7fe;color:#111;border-color:#d1e7fe}.singleOpportunity__content{max-width:800px;color:hsla(0,0%,7%,.6)}.singleOpportunity__content p{margin-bottom:20px}.singleOpportunity__content p:last-child{margin-bottom:0}.singleOpportunity__contentBlock{display:-ms-flexbox;display:flex;padding-top:80px;padding-bottom:80px;margin:0 -24px}@media only screen and (max-width:769px){.singleOpportunity__contentBlock{-ms-flex-direction:column-reverse;flex-direction:column-reverse;padding-top:48px;padding-bottom:48px}}.singleOpportunity__contentBlock__text{margin-bottom:40px}@media only screen and (max-width:992px){.singleOpportunity__contentBlock__text{margin-bottom:32px}}@media only screen and (max-width:769px){.singleOpportunity__contentBlock__text{margin-bottom:24px}}.singleOpportunity__contentBlock__textWrapper{width:50%;padding:0 24px}@media only screen and (max-width:769px){.singleOpportunity__contentBlock__textWrapper{width:100%}}.singleOpportunity__contentBlock__textWrapper.full-width{width:100%}.singleOpportunity__contentBlock__image{padding:0 24px;width:50%;position:relative}@media only screen and (max-width:769px){.singleOpportunity__contentBlock__image{width:100%;margin-bottom:24px}}.singleOpportunity__contentBlock__image img{border-radius:16px;width:100%;position:absolute;top:0;width:calc(100% - 48px);left:24px;height:100%}.singleOpportunity__contentBlock__title{margin-bottom:24px}.singleOpportunity__contentBlock__cards{margin-bottom:-12px}.singleOpportunity__contentBlock__cardsItem{background-color:#d1e7fe;padding:24px;border-radius:18px;margin-bottom:12px;display:-ms-flexbox;display:flex;-ms-flex-align:start;align-items:flex-start}@media only screen and (max-width:769px){.singleOpportunity__contentBlock__cardsItem{-ms-flex-direction:column;flex-direction:column}}.singleOpportunity__contentBlock__cardsItem__icon{padding:8px;margin-right:24px;border-radius:8px;background-color:#003153}@media only screen and (max-width:769px){.singleOpportunity__contentBlock__cardsItem__icon{margin-bottom:12px}}.singleOpportunity__contentBlock__cardsItem__icon img{width:32px;height:32px}.singleOpportunity__contentBlock__cardsItem__title{margin-bottom:16px}@media only screen and (max-width:769px){.singleOpportunity__contentBlock__cardsItem__title{margin-bottom:12px}}.singleOpportunity__contentBlock__textWrapper.full-width .singleOpportunity__contentBlock__cards{display:-ms-flexbox;display:flex;gap:12px;-ms-flex-wrap:wrap;flex-wrap:wrap}.singleOpportunity__contentBlock__textWrapper.full-width .singleOpportunity__contentBlock__cardsItem{width:calc(50% - 6px)}@media only screen and (max-width:769px){.singleOpportunity__contentBlock__textWrapper.full-width .singleOpportunity__contentBlock__cardsItem{width:100%}}.singleOpportunity__banner{padding:120px 0;position:relative}@media only screen and (max-width:992px){.singleOpportunity__banner{padding:80px 0}}@media only screen and (max-width:769px){.singleOpportunity__banner{padding:64px 0}}.singleOpportunity__bannerImage{position:absolute;top:0;left:0;width:100%;height:100%}.singleOpportunity__bannerImage img{height:100%;-o-object-fit:cover;object-fit:cover}.singleOpportunity__banner .container{position:relative;z-index:1}.singleOpportunity__bannerContent{display:-ms-flexbox;display:flex;gap:48px}@media only screen and (max-width:769px){.singleOpportunity__bannerContent{-ms-flex-direction:column;flex-direction:column;gap:28px}}.singleOpportunity__bannerContent>*{width:calc(50% - 24px)}@media only screen and (max-width:769px){.singleOpportunity__bannerContent>*{width:100%}}.singleOpportunity__bannerText{margin-bottom:24px}